Zac Dalpe (born November 1, 1989 in Paris , Ontario ) is a Canadian ice hockey player who has been under contract with the Columbus Blue Jackets in the National Hockey League since February 2017 and for their farm team, the Cleveland Monsters , in the American Hockey League is used.

Career

Zac Dalpe began his career as a hockey player with the Penticton Vees, for which he was active in the Canadian junior league British Columbia Hockey League in the 2007/08 season . With his team he immediately won the championship title of the BCHL, whose Most Sportsmanlike Player he was named. In the 2008 NHL Entry Draft , he was selected in the second round as the 45th player by the Carolina Hurricanes . The center then attended Ohio State University for two years , for whose ice hockey team he played in parallel in the National Collegiate Athletic Association . In 2009 he was elected to the all-rookie team of the Central Collegiate Hockey Association and a year later to the first all-star team of the university league.

Towards the end of the 2009/10 season , Dalpe made his professional ice hockey debut for Carolina's farm team Albany River Rats , for which he played 17 games in the American Hockey League , scoring nine goals and four assists. In the 2010/11 season , the right- shooter stood in a total of 77 games for Carolina's new AHL farm team Charlotte Checkers on the ice and scored 70 points, including 29 goals. Because of his performance at the Checkers, he was elected to the AHL All-Rookie Team at the end of the season . During the season he also came to 15 appearances in the National Hockey League for the Carolina Hurricanes, scoring three goals and one assist.

On September 29, 2013, Dalpe was transferred to the Vancouver Canucks together with Jeremy Welsh , which gave Kellan Tochkin and a four-round vote in the 2014 NHL Entry Draft to the Hurricanes. He was then able to secure a regular place in the Canucks' NHL squad.

In the summer of 2014, Dalpe moved to the Buffalo Sabers and signed a one-year contract there. After this expired, he joined the Minnesota Wild in July 2015 . There he missed a large part of the service time due to injuries and switched regularly between the NHL and AHL, where he was signed by the Columbus Blue Jackets waiver in February 2017 .
